I find it maddening how much the pop media is focusing on trite disputes between Tea Partier GOPs and so-called Socialist Democrats. Glenn Beck and O'Reill are obviously at fault, but also Maddow and even Jon Stewart (although he's a comedian, he's been a haven for liberal-minded audiences, so bares some responsibility) are occupying their shows with this GOP/DEM dichotomy. The absurd theater that ensues between them is a nice distraction from what is actually going on in Capitol Hill. The Democrats have turned into broad sweeping party, from conservative to moderate to slightly liberal, diluting the interests of the people with the interest of big business. They are a very successful party and their interests in dealing with these bills are with lobbyists.





Here's an article about how the Democratic Party is expanding while becoming the party of choice for big business:

American Empire is Bankrupt by Chris Hedges

http://www.truthdig.com/report/page2/20090614_the_american_empire_is_bankrupt/


"The architects of this new global exchange realize that if they break the dollar they also break America’s military domination. Our military spending cannot be sustained without this cycle of heavy borrowing. The official U.S. defense budget for fiscal year 2008 is $623 billion, before we add on things like nuclear research. The next closest national military budget is China’s, at $65 billion, according to the Central Intelligence Agency."
